An Open House will be held at the Lyons Heritage Society on July 12, from 10 to 4 at the Hotchkiss Essential Oil Building on Water St.

Tours of this unique building will be given throughout the day. This business was known all over the world for pure 'Hotchkiss Essential Oils.'

H.G. Hotchkiss brought fame to Lyons as 'The Peppermint King.' Many farmers in the county grew and sold peppermint to Hotchkiss, who also owned a number of peppermint fields.

Lyons Heritage Society will have a new exhibit showcasing donations from Lyons residents and from the estates of Phyllis Mood Wells (granddaughter of Emma Rise Rudd) and Betsy Foster Matecki.

Another exhibit includes items on loan from the Lyons Fire department. Memorabilia from the 1800's and early 1900's will be displayed along with pictures of some of the village's most famous fires.
